Darryl Rahn is a Brooklyn-based indie folk artist with a well-seasoned homegrown sound. Born in a small suburb in upstate New York, he is inspired by his community’s unique landscapes, grandmother’s red-sauce recipes, and an internal grappling over the fact that he never hit a home run in little league. His narrative-rich lyrics conjured from an admiration of great American writers from Raymond Carver to Tim Robinson paired with his signature chromatic guitar style have earned him spots on stages and in regular collaboration with the likes of Dawes, Willow Avalon, and Samia to name a few.
